Find clues … WebA totalitarian regime has a highly centralized system of government that requires strict obedience. An authoritarian regime focuses on the maintenance of order at the expense of personal freedom. A fascist regime is a government that embraces extreme nationalism, violence, and action with the goal of internal cleansing and external expansion.

Totalitarianism is a form of government and a political system that prohibits all opposition parties, outlaws individual and group opposition to the state and its claims, and exercises an extremely high if not complete degree of control and regulation over public and private life. It is regarded as the most extreme and complete form of authoritarianism. In totalitarian states, political power is often … WebRank the most Brutal Famous 20th Century Dictators. 1. Joseph Stalin.
